Options for the 944S2:
Sell the 16V Head and put on a Turbo 8V and full Turbo stuff including Computer
(DME + KLR). Water and Oil passages need slight machine shop mod to fit. DME. Buy a junked Car and rape and pillage what you need from exhaust to Intercooler. Price $3000+??
Or you could maybe find a 968 Head with Vario Cam (like V-tech) + DME and instant 30HP

Bore the 3.0L to a 3.4L and add those higher CR pistons. Say Custom made CP’s at 108mm. If you go above say, 11.5 CR you will need to use only Race gas or ping ping boom. The Knock sensor will retard the timing a bit to compensate some for lower Octane fuel. Custom piston ring Set, Custom Copper Gasket. From what I’ve gather Stroking this Engine is a lot of work for Min results. I was told this because the way the position of Wrist Pin. Also the clearance of the Connecting Rod on the bottom of the block. They can do a staggered Crank Grind where is effetely positions it’s center further from the center of Crank, thus increasing Stroke. But all the stroker options are a lot of expense for little result.
